Coconut, calamansi, carageenan, moringa have big potential in Europe – study
January 19, 2021A market study found that coconut, calamansi, carrageenan, and moringa have big potential in European markets. Other Philippine agricultural products cited were ube, turmeric, butterfly pea flower, and the elemi tree. The demand is driven by healthy lifestyle choices and using natural ingredients in manufacturing cosmetics and medicines.Read More -
